目的了解2型糖尿病(T2DM)患者糖化血红蛋白(HbA1c)控制情况,以及HbA1c达标与并发症、血脂、患者满意度依从性的相关关系。方法随机选取正在门诊进行降糖治疗的2型糖尿病患者490例,按HbA1c是否达标分为达标组(HbA1c≤6.5%,148例)和未达标组(HbA1c>6.5%,342例)。采用问卷调查的方式收集患者一般情况、患者满意度、依从性等相关资料。然后分别测定其糖化血红蛋白(HbA1c)、总胆固醇(TC)、三酰甘油(TG)、高密度脂蛋白(HDL-C)、低密度脂蛋白(LDL-C),对该类患者血糖达标情况进行统计学描述和分析。结果符合入选条件患者共490例,HbA1c达标率为30.2%。未达标组中并发症发生率明显大于达标组(P<0.05)。达标组的血脂水平明显低于未达标组。达标组中患者的满意度及依从性明显大于未达标组(P<0.05)。结论目前2型糖尿病患者HbA1c达标率为30.2%,达标控制并不理想。HbA1c达标有利于减少并发症的发生,降低TC、TG、LDL-C水平。血糖达标组的患者较未达标组患者满意度高且依从性较好。
Objective To investigate the control of glycosylated hemoglobin (HbA1c) in type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) and the relationship between HbA1c compliance and complication, blood lipid and patient satisfaction. Methods 490 pat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us undergoing hypoglycemic treatment were randomly selected and divided into the standard group (HbA1c≤6.5%, 148 cases) and the non-compliance group (HbA1c> 6.5%, 342 cases) according to whether HbA1c was up to standard. Using questionnaires to collect the general condition of patients, patient satisfaction, compliance and other related information. Then the levels of HbA1c, TC, TG, HDL-C and LDL-C were determined respectively, and the blood sugar level of these patients was reached Statistical description and analysis. Results A total of 490 patients met the inclusion criteria, and the HbA1c compliance rate was 30.2%. The incidence of complications in the non-compliance group was significantly higher than that in the compliance group (P <0.05). The standard group of blood lipid levels were significantly lower than the non-compliance group. Satisfaction and compliance of the patients in the standard group were significantly higher than those in the non-compliance group (P <0.05). Conclusions The prevalence of HbA1c in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us is 30.2% at present, and the compliance control is not satisfactory. HbA1c compliance is conducive to reduce the incidence of complications, reduce TC, TG, LDL-C levels. Patients in the standard glucose group were more satisfied and compliant than those who did not.
